How Jail Information Systems Generally Function

Most county jails, including Cowlitz County Jail, utilize standardized booking procedures that are designed to manage intake efficiently and securely. When someone is arrested, they are processed through a system that records basic details such as name, date of birth, and the alleged charges. This information is typically entered into a digital database that is often accessible to the public, albeit with specific privacy safeguards in place. The goal of these systems is administrative transparency while protecting the legal rights of individuals. Addressing Common Misunderstandings

A significant misunderstanding is that seeing an inmate listed implies a conviction has occurred. In reality, the majority of people in jail are legally innocent until proven guilty, held only while awaiting trial. Another myth is that these facilities are uniformly overcrowded and underfunded; while challenges exist, conditions vary widely based on funding and local policies. It is also incorrect to assume that all inmates are there for violent crimes; many are held for non-violent offenses related to poverty or addiction. By correcting these inaccuracies, the public can develop a more empathetic and realistic perspective, reducing stigma and promoting supportive solutions.
